Iron Mask

Directed by Oleg Stepchenko, for the first time, screen legends Arnold Schwarzenegger and Jackie Chan face off against each other in battle in this epic fantasy adventure, Iron Mask.

To save his homeland from certain doom, a kung fu master, played by Chan, must escape from the maniacal James Hook, played by Schwarzenegger, to send his daughter a secret talisman that will allow her to control a massive and mythical dragon.

This larger-than-life, globe-trotting tale – ranging from the impenetrable Tower of London to the fabled Silk Road and China’s Great Wall – also stars Rutger Hauer in one of the screen icon’s final performances.

The rest of the talented cast includes Jason Flemyng, Yao Xingtong, Anna Churina, Yuri Kolokolnikov, Martin Klebba, Charles Dance, and Christopher Fairbank.
